0002213HrbekThe International Research Fellow Awards Program enables U.S. scientists and engineers to conduct three to twenty-four months of research abroad. The program's awards provide opportunities for joint research, and the use of unique orcomplementary facilities, expertise and experimental conditions abroad.This award will provide Dr. Tomas Hrbek with support fortwenty-four months to work with Dr. Axel Meyer at the University of Konstanz in Germany on a project entitled "Testing the Temporal Assumption of Mayr's Geographic Speciation Model."This project will use the killifish genus Aphanius as a model system to test distributional and speciational hypotheses as impacted by the Plio-Pleistocene Mediterranean Sea level fluctuations, the Messinian salinity crisis, orogenic events associated with closing of the Tethys Sea, and the drying of the central Anatolian plateau. Mayr's model of speciation postulates that the range of a single species must be broken up into discontinuous regions, with little or no gene flow between them, in order for speciation to occur. Dr. Hrbek will use molecular data to generate a phylogeny of Aphanius and will do a population genetic study of the Aphanius anatoliae species complex. A detailed molecular analyses will allow him to test temporal and spatial processes leading to patterns of diversification and speciation which are exemplified in that genus. Such an analysis will also aid conservation efforts of this group of fishes, which appear to be endangered in many areas of their distribution.The host lab is especially well suited for this project, having a very active research group and an extensive professional contact with the European evolutionary community.
